Complete Guide to Places to Visit in Nainital
Nainital sits at 2,084 metres in the Kumaon Hills, centred around the stunning Naini Lake. The town is famous for its colonial architecture, boating, and panoramic viewpoints overlooking the Kumaon Himalayas.
| Place | Type | Highlights |
|---|---|---|
| Naini Lake | Lake / boating | Heart of Nainital; rowing, pedal boats, yachting |
| Naina Devi Temple | Shakti Peeth temple | One of 64 Shakti Peethas; on the lake shore |
| Snow View Point | Viewpoint / ropeway | 2,270m; Nanda Devi and Trishul peaks visible |
| Tiffin Top | Viewpoint / 4 km trek | Sunrise; 360° Himalayan panorama |
| Eco Cave Gardens | Natural caves | 6 interconnected rock caves; great for families |
| Raj Bhavan | Heritage / garden | Governor's colonial-era palace; guided tours |
| Bhimtal Lake | Day trip | 22 km; larger than Naini; aquarium island |
| Sattal | Day trip / birding | Seven lakes; top birding site in Kumaon |
| Hanuman Garhi | Temple / sunset | 3 km; best sunset view over the lake |
| Mukteshwar | Day trip | 51 km; 2,286m; stunning Himalayan views |
Best Time to Visit Nainital
- March – June: Peak season; 10–25°C; all activities open; book in advance
- October – November: Ideal — clear views, fewer crowds, perfect hiking weather
- December – January: Snowfall possible; romantic but cold
- July – September: Monsoon; lush but trails can be slippery
How to Reach Nainital
- By Road: Delhi → Nainital (300 km, ~7 hrs) via Moradabad; buses from Delhi ISBT (₹350–₹600)
- By Train: Kathgodam Station (35 km) — Shatabdi from Delhi (5.5 hrs)
- By Air: Pantnagar Airport (65 km); Jolly Grant Dehradun (290 km) better connected
- Local: Shared taxis Kathgodam → Nainital (1 hr, ₹150); private cab ₹600–₹800

Travel Tips and FAQs
- Private vehicles restricted on Mall Road — use Tallital or Mallital parking
- Book Snow View ropeway tickets online to avoid peak-season queues
- Best boating: early morning 7–9 AM before crowds arrive
- Combine with Bhimtal, Sattal and Mukteshwar for a 4-day Kumaon circuit
- Buy Nainital's famous candles, jams and woollen shawls from Tibetan Market
FAQ: May is peak season — book hotels 4–6 weeks ahead. October is less crowded and equally beautiful.
